I'm having some problems in filtering data in a multiple graph variables.
So, I plot a graph with the variables columns but i cant create a filter using the group variables (columns) : Sensor1, Sensor2 ....
I trying to create a filter for the user choose what variable he wants to plot in the graph.
Solved! Go to Solution.
Right click time column and select Unpivot Other Columns.
You may select Unpivot Columns in Query Editor, then drag Attribute to Legend and Value to Values.
